... Read moreMaking mistakes is a natural part of growth, but there are certain situations where avoiding errors is paramount. Whether you're pursuing a critical career goal, managing finances, or making a significant life decision, the stakes can be high, and the margin for error very small. One effective strategy to minimize mistakes is to cultivate a mindset of careful planning and reflection. Before taking action, thoroughly analyze available information and consider possible outcomes. This preparation helps identify potential pitfalls before they occur. Additionally, seeking feedback from trusted mentors or colleagues can provide alternative perspectives and prevent oversight. It’s also crucial to develop strong problem-solving skills and emotional resilience. When errors do happen, learning from them promptly and constructively can turn setbacks into opportunities for growth. Embracing a proactive approach, such as continuous learning and skill refinement, keeps you adaptable and better prepared for complex challenges. Technological tools like digital calendars, project management apps, and reminders further aid in reducing unintentional mistakes by organizing tasks and deadlines clearly. Maintaining focus and limiting distractions during work can improve accuracy and efficiency. Lastly, maintaining a healthy lifestyle, including proper sleep and exercise, ensures mental clarity and sound judgment. In sum, the key to avoiding costly mistakes lies in preparation, continuous learning, seeking advice, leveraging technology, and self-care. By committing to these habits, you can navigate critical decisions with greater confidence and precision, ultimately leading to personal and professional success.
